Volunteer to help care for orphaned and vulnerable children in Swaziland.

With one of Africa's highest HIV / AIDS rates, many of Swaziland's children have lost their parents and thus face food shortages, lack of adequate shelter and care, and most of all lack of attention and love. Volunteer on this project and you will be able to assist these orphans. Based at one of the project's child care centers you may help with hands-on teaching, organizing of activities, caring for the children, arranging food, assessing needs, developing the center and more.

The Orphan Care Project aims to assist these vulnerable children in a number of different ways; by giving them basic education, transferring skills, providing meals, helping to guide and care for the children, while giving them love and adult support. Many of these children cannot afford to attend school and their hope for a bright future lies in the support of these care centers and our volunteers. With high unemployment (50%) and limited state welfare, many of these children's needs cannot be met without volunteer involvement.
The project involves a number of small care centers in Swaziland, some of which are basic, rough structures and others are more organized and developed. All are in need of support and are run by people who volunteer their time and efforts.

The specific aims of these centers vary but in general they provide orphaned and vulnerable children with basic food, care and education. Food is often grown in local gardens and some is donated. In addition to the education and care activities some centers need assistance with small infrastructure developments such as gardens, water systems and other physical structures.

The project is also involved in the investigation and research of areas of need and works to raise awareness locally and worldwide, through the help of volunteers, of the children and their needs.

Volunteer role

As a volunteer on the Orphan Care Project you will be working with existing Neighborhood Care Points in the local community with the aim of teaching basic education, such as math and English of which we can provide you with teaching aids and resources, arranging sport days for the children, creating craft masterpieces with the children, helping them with eating their breakfast and lunch meals, and just giving them the love and attention that they so desperately need.

You will also assist in completing profiles of the children so that we are aware of their ongoing needs and circumstances.
